WebSep 19, 2016 · The Pork and Apple, is made with diced apples, according to the front label, and apple sauce and diced apple according to the back of the packet. It’s a very good mass-produced pie. The pastry has a bit of a crunch to it, the meat has a good flavour, there is a little jelly and when you’ve finished one, you would like another.
